Есть ли хорошее руководство о том, как установить CUDA в linux по произвольному пути (кроме /usr /local)? Я уже установил одну версию, и я хотел бы установить вторую. Кроме того, как я могу узнать, какой из них лучше для меня по моему GPU?
1 ответ
НАКОНЕЦ, я нашел это в официальной документации,
Установка Runfile спросит, где вы хотите установить Toolkit и Samples во время интерактивной установки. При установке с использованием неинтерактивной установки вы можете использовать параметры --toolkitpath и --samplespath, чтобы изменить место установки:
./runfile.run --silent \
--toolkit --toolkitpath=/my/new/toolkit \
--samples --samplespath=/my/new/samples
Пакеты RPM не поддерживают пользовательские местоположения установки, хотя менеджеры пакетов (Yum и Zypper), но можно установить пакеты RPM в пользовательские местоположения, используя параметр --relocate rpm:
$ rpm --install --relocate /usr/local/cuda-6.5=/my/new/toolkit rpmpackage.rpm
Пакеты Deb не поддерживают пользовательские места установки через менеджер пакетов (apt), но можно установить пакеты Deb в пользовательских местах с помощью параметра dpkg - instdir
$ dpkg --instdir=/my/new/toolkit --install debpackage.deb
Для пакетов RPM и Deb вам необходимо установить пакеты в правильном порядке зависимости; обычно менеджеры пакетов позаботятся об этом автоматически. Например, если пакет "foo" имеет зависимость от пакета "bar", вы должны сначала установить пакет "bar", а затем пакет "foo". Вы можете проверить зависимости RPM или Deb пакета следующим образом
$ rpm -qRp rpmpackage.rpm
$ dpkg -I debpackage.deb | grep Depends